The Xience Pro S Coronary Stent by Abbott (REF 1508300-15) is a drug-eluting coronary stent system in a 3.00 mm × 15 mm configuration, designed for use in percutaneous coronary intervention procedures. It belongs to Abbott's established Xience family of everolimus-eluting coronary stents used by interventional cardiology teams.
Key Features
Everolimus drug-eluting coronary stent platform
Nominal diameter: 3.00 mm
Stent length: 15 mm
Pre-mounted on a rapid-exchange delivery catheter
Cobalt chromium stent platform per Xience family design
Sterile, single-use device
Clinical Applications
Intended for use by trained interventional cardiologists in percutaneous coronary intervention
Treatment of de novo coronary artery lesions in suitable patients
Supports revascularization workflows in cardiac catheterization laboratories
